FlippJ Posted September 2, 2007 Report Share Posted September 2, 2007 The game was scoreless until the midway point of the second quarter. McCallie pressured Franklin's QB into a bad throw, intercepted it, and returned it for a TD. Franklin's defense played decent I thought, but their offense seemed to put them behind the 8-ball all game long. They had a breakdown in the secondary on McCallie's final drive of the first half and McCallie capitalized on it with a long pass. A few plays later McCallie scored a TD on a short pass to take a 14-0 halftime lead. Franklin's offense came out in the second half and moved the ball, but they just couldn't sustain anything. McCallie's defense did a good job of stopping the running game and pressuring the QB. McCallie pretty much dictated the tempo of the game. Franklin made a lot of mistakes. Not only were there 3 interceptions, but Franklin also fumbled a punt deep in their own territory giving McCallie the ball inside their 5 yard line. McCallie was up 21-0 at this point and scored again making it 28-0. McCallie scored 2 TDs in the second quarter, and another 2 in the fourth quarter. Franklin scored a garbage TD on their final drive of the game making it 28-6 (they missed the extra point).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
